如何用C 實現簡單的序列化 反序列化庫?請說明大體思路?

時間 2021-06-03 09:50:32

1樓:cozilla

來個冷門的,微軟的bond, https://

nd類似於protobuf.

2樓:大釗

也可以參考我的引擎裡的Siren模組。

Medusa/Medusa/MedusaCore/Core/Siren at master · fjz13/Medusa · GitHub

3樓:歐文韜

protobuf,sproto,msgpack,json,bson

隨便照著乙個來唄

感覺你的意思的話好像比較像msgpack-c的方法

4樓:陳碩

zhihu.com/question/47613023/answer/106833162第2點。

5樓:Pluto Hades

成熟方案:

1.Google Protocol Buffers(protobuf)

2.Boost.Serialization簡單思路:

struct

T_T;

| ↑

序反列序化列

| 化

↓ |,,,]}

django restful裡序列化和反序列化是什麼意思,怎麼使用?

劉白給zz 如果閱讀Django REST Framework的文件,你會發現serializer實際上做了一件事情serilization isntance native datatype Json,將model例項的轉為json格式response出去。同理,deserializer則是Json...

c 哪個json序列化庫好?

用的jansson,非常好用。最初是見很多知名開源專案用它,也直接用了,沒有和QQ等做對比。不過因為很好用,就一直用下去了。 yc znone 推薦nlohmann json,這個好用,開發效率高。現在支援json序列化結構的庫也有不少了,比如這個,除了json,還支援其他的文件格式 leech。 ...

如何用c 實現鍊表類的操作?

include template T class Node template T class List 預設建構函式 template T List List 拷貝建構函式 template T List List const List ln tail next nullptr 向鍊表新增資料 te...